Gall Bladder

Conditions affecting the gallbladder, a small organ that helps digestion.

  • Your gallbladder is a four-inch, pear-shaped organ. It’s positioned under your liver in the upper-right section of your abdomen.
  • The gallbladder stores bile, a combination of fluids, fat, and cholesterol. Bile helps break down fat from food in your intestine.
  • Gallstones are hardened deposits of digestive fluid.
  • Gallstones can vary in size and number and may or may not cause symptoms.
  • People who experience symptoms usually require gallbladder removal surgery. Gallstones that don’t cause symptoms usually don’t need treatment.

              Pain areas: In the back or upper-right abdomen
              Pain types: Can be severe
             Gastrointestinal: Indigestion, nausea, or vomiting
             Abdominal: Cramping from gallstones or discomfort
